Stones can be bought from Robin at 20 gold each, resulting in a price of 1980 gold per Staircase. You can, with enough money or patience, completely fill your inventory with stacks of 999 Stones, enter the Skull Cave, and immediately craft and set down a new Staircase every time you go down a level. If you have read Secret Note #10, once you reach Level 100 of the Skull Cavern, Mr Qi will be waiting for you. If you arrive having used 10 or …Don't even fight them. You aren't there for them or minerals, you are there to reach 100. Just tear through the level setting bombs and absorbing hits jump in the first hole or descend the first ladder you come to and keep going. Stop only to eat to keep your health high but do that often, don't go under 50%.If attempting the level 100 quest: Good luck day. Desert totem (to get over at 6am) Use staircases as needed: as long as you use <= 10 you get the "good ending" for the quest (although there is no practical difference in-game—it just changes the quest closing dialogue) Reset day if you don't make it. johnpeters42 • 2 yr. ago.

The Skull Cavern is similar to that of the regular mine in Stardew Valley, but you'll find it in the northwest of Calico Desert. To access it you'll need to get yourself a Skull Key, which is rewarded once you reach level 120 of the normal mines. The difference between the cavern and the mine is that the mine will 'save' your progress.1. If you’re almost at level 100 and about to pass out don’t worry about going home. You don’t lose anything from your inventory just 1000 gold. Whenever I do a skull cavern run I never go back home I just wait to pass out, the two extra hours can get you a lot.
